Instructions
Soak dried mushrooms in hot water for 15 minutes. Strain mushrooms through a sieve, reserving liquid. While the mushrooms are soaking, cook tortellini according to package directions.
While the tortellini is cooking, he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
Add shallots and garlic and cook 3 minutes, stirring with spoon until soft.
Add oregano and bay leaves and cook 1 minute, until fragrant.
Add porcini mushrooms and reserved mushroom soaking liquid and bring to a simmer, for 5 minutes. Reduce heat to medium, add heavy cream and simmer 2 minutes to heat through.
Remove bay leaves with tongs, add tortellini to the mushrooms and cook 1 minute, to heat through.
Remove from heat and stir in cheese and parsley.
